In eCommerce Services (eCS), we build systems that span the full range of eCommerce functionality, from Privacy, Identity, Purchase Experience and Ordering to Shipping, Tax and Financial integration. eCommerce Services manages several aspects of the customer life cycle, starting from account creation and sign in, to placing items in the shopping cart, proceeding through checkout, order processing, managing order history and post-fulfillment actions such as refunds and tax invoices. eCS services determine sales tax and shipping charges, and we ensure the privacy of our customers. Our mission is to provide a commerce foundation that accelerates business innovation and delivers a secure, available, performant, and reliable shopping experience to Amazon’s customers.
